#7e0128 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#7e0128 is composed of 49.4% red, 0.4% green and 15.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 99.2% magenta, 68.3% yellow and 50.6% black. It has a hue angle of 341.3 degrees, a saturation of 98.4% and a lightness of 24.9%. #7e0128 color hex could be obtained by blending #fc0250 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660033.

Shades and Tints of #7e0128

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#090003 is the darkest color, while #fff5f8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#7e0128

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#433c3e is the less saturated color, while #7e0128 is the most saturated one.
